The United States Electronic Thesis and Dissertation Association (USETDA) will hold its 13th annual conference from September 20 – 21, 2023 as a virtual event via Zoom. About USETDA 2023USETDA 2023 will provide excellent educational opportunities for graduate school, library, disability and student services, offices of diversity, equity and inclusion, information technology and industry professionals and others who work with electronic theses and dissertations (ETDs), institutional repositories, graduate students and scholarly communications.
The conference theme “Access and Accessibility: Exploring Equity and Inclusion in Digital Scholarship” will delve into accessibility as it impacts various aspects of the creation and dissemination of scholarly work. We will examine the present use and availability of ETDs and related initiatives. We will also explore new and emerging ETD practices, needs, and influences that impact administrative, graduate school, and library professionals.
